Market Outlook
According to the report by Expert Market Research (EMR), the global ultra-secure smartphone market size reached a value of USD 3.21 billion in 2023. Aided by the increased deployment of advanced biometric authentication methods in smartphones, the market is projected to further grow at a CAGR of 21.7% between 2024 and 2032 to reach a value of USD 18.88 billion by 2032.
Ultra-secure smartphones are designed to offer advanced security features that protect against cyber threats, data breaches, and unauthorized access. These devices are equipped with robust encryption, secure booting, and secure application environments, making them ideal for use in industries that handle sensitive information, such as government, military, finance, and healthcare. The rising incidences of cyber-attacks and data breaches are driving the demand for ultra-secure smartphones, as organizations and individuals increasingly seek solutions to protect their data and privacy.
The growing awareness of data security and privacy concerns is propelling the ultra-secure smartphone market growth. With the increasing reliance on mobile devices for personal and professional use, there has been a significant shift towards prioritizing security features in smartphones. Additionally, the rising adoption of remote working practices and the increasing use of mobile devices for accessing corporate networks have further contributed to the demand for ultra-secure smartphones, as they provide an added layer of security for remote access.
The expanding applications of ultra-secure smartphones in various industries also play a significant role in propelling the market. In the government and military sectors, ultra-secure smartphones are used for secure communications and data protection. The healthcare industry utilizes ultra-secure smartphones to safeguard patient data and ensure compliance with regulatory standards, such as HIPAA. Moreover, the financial sector relies on ultra-secure smartphones to protect sensitive financial information and prevent fraud.
